Sausage Soup Recipe with Gluten Free Pasta

Modified: Mar 30, 2026 Published: Mar 24, 2026 by Sabrina Quairoli Visit our "Disclosure Policy and Cookies" page in the menu for details. This post may contain affiliate links.

Jump to Recipe·Print Recipe
Spread the Love

Sausage soup is a perfect way to keep your dinner flavorful and all cooked in one saucepan. Using a 5-quart cast-iron saucepan for a family of four is perfect for weeknight dinners. This one is especially great for family members with gluten intolerances. As a bonus, it is also dairy-free. Yay! If you want to try it, feel free to follow the instructions below. Ingredients

1 tablespoon olive oil (affiliate)
2 links or ½ LB of sweet Italian sausage - remove the casing
2 garlic cloves - minced
¾ cup of finely chopped onion
½ cup of chopped carrots - I chopped baby carrots
½ cup of chopped celery
4 teaspoon Dried Parsley
2 teaspoon Dried Basil
1 15.5 oz. can of diced tomatoes (affiliate)
3 cups of chicken broth (affiliate) - GF DF
½ cup of gluten-free star pasta - I used Jovial's gluten-free Stelline pasta (affiliate).
1 teaspoon salt
½ teaspoon pepper

Instructions

Celery, onion and carrot chopped square image

Prep the ingredients.

Remove the casing of the Italian sausage and set it aside.

Chop the onion and celery, then set them aside.

Measure out the parsley and basil, salt, and pepper. Set aside.

Mince garlic and measure out 1 tablespoon of olive oil (affiliate). Set aside.

Measure out 2-3 cups of broth (1 extra cup of broth if they need it). And, open the can of diced tomatoes and measure out 2 ½ cups of star pasta.

Sausage without the casing square image

Let's start cookin'!

In a saucepan over medium to high heat, add the olive oil (affiliate). Then add the sausage links without casings. Break it up into pieces with a wooden spoon.

Cook and keep breaking up the sausage for about 5 minutes or until lightly browned.

celery carrots and onions in saucepan - square image

Then, add the garlic for a minute. Then, add the celery, onion, and carrots. Sauté for 5 more minutes.

Tomatoes diced, herbs, and other things in a saucepan - square image

Then add the tomatoes, parsley, basil, salt, pepper, and broth, and stir.

Bring to a boil. Reduce the heat to medium-low, place the lid partially open to allow steam to escape, then cook for 15 minutes. Stirring occasionally.

While boiling, add the gluten-free pasta and cook for 10 minutes, or according to the instructions on the box.

Stir constantly so the pasta doesn't stick.

Serve in a bowl. This recipe makes four servings.

Questions and Answers for this Sausage Soup Recipe.

Can I make this sausage soup recipe spicy?


Absolutely, you can easily add red pepper flakes to the olive oil step to spice it up. 

Can I use Turkey sausage instead of pork sausage?

Yes, you can easily swap out the pork sausage for turkey or chicken sausage. Just make sure it is NOT a cooked sausage variety. 

Can I use regular soup pasta with this recipe?

Absolutely. Make sure you can cook the pasta according to the instructions on the box. 

Do I need to add the pasta to this sausage soup recipe?

No, not at all. Just adjust the cooking to exclude the pasta cooking time.

What can I add to this sausage soup recipe to make it my own?

Spicy - add 1 tablespoon of red pepper flakes or cayenne pepper (½ tsp) or to your spice preference.
Add greens - after the pasta is cooked, turn off the burner, and then add a handful or two of fresh spinach or power greens and cover with a lid and let it wilt for 5-10 minutes.

What is the best tip for this sausage soup with pasta recipe to make it cook quickly?

The smaller you make the celery, onion, and carrots, the quicker the recipe will cook.

How long can I store this cooked sausage soup with pasta recipe in the refrigerator?

If you place it in the refrigerator, it will last 3-4 days. But it won't last that long. lol

How long can I store this cooked sausage soup recipe in the freezer?

I don't recommend freezing this recipe because the soup will stick together and turn into a blob of nothing. 

What equipment is necessary for this sausage soup recipe?

The equipment is pretty easy. I used a 5 qt cast-iron saucepan, a cutting board, a chef's knife, and a container to store the soup.
